Top Greige Cabinet Colors Designers Love

1. Agreeable Gray by Sherwin Williams

This chameleon color shifts beautifully depending on lighting. Pro tip: It looks incredible with brass hardware and white marble countertops.

2. Revere Pewter by Benjamin Moore

Think of this as the Swiss Army knife of neutrals. It adapts, it complements, it makes your kitchen look professionally designed.

Design Strategies for Greige Cabinets

Styling Tricks That Never Fail:
  • Pair with white quartz countertops
  • Add brass or matte black fixtures
  • Use natural wood accent pieces
  • Layer textures to create depth

Budget-Friendly Greige Options

Budget doesn’t mean boring. Ready-to-assemble (RTA) greige cabinet sets start around $3,564, making your dream kitchen totally achievable.

Pro Designer Secrets
  • Light greige makes spaces feel larger
  • Darker greige adds dramatic sophistication
  • Always test paint samples in YOUR lighting

What to Avoid

Greige Mistakes to Dodge:
  • Skipping paint samples
  • Ignoring room’s natural light
  • Matching everything too perfectly
  • Forgetting about undertones
